“WDC” continues to have a major impact on 14895

By Andrew Harris

At this point, it is hard to imagine a downtown Wellsville without this non-profit corporation, or the board members who make it so successful. A quick read through the list of WDC volunteers explains why they have made such a dramatic impact. They are business owners, event organizers, and lifelong advocates for Wellsville who enjoy making this a better place to live. It is very simple: These people simply enjoy improving the quality of life for everyone who lives or visits Wellsville.
